AI Summary
-
Establishes a task force to study issues concerning hoarding, effective upon passage.
-
Task force shall review current methods used by public agencies to address hoarding, identify barriers to intervention and assistance, and create a framework to coordinate efforts among state and local agencies.
-
Task force comprises 16 members including representatives from fire marshals, police chiefs, municipalities, legal aid, mental health advocacy, building inspection, animal control, and various state commissioners.
-
Speaker of the House and President Pro Tempore of the Senate shall jointly select task force chairpersons, who shall schedule the first meeting within 60 days of the effective date.
-
Task force shall submit findings and recommendations to the joint standing committee on public safety and security by January 1, 2016, and shall terminate upon submission of the report or January 1, 2016, whichever is later.
